Campus Marketing Statement

Lone Star College offers high-quality, low-cost academic transfer and career training education to 80,000+ students each semester. LSC has been named a 2023 Great Colleges to Work For institution by the Chronicle of Higher Education.

LSC consists of eight colleges, seven centers, eight Workforce Centers of Excellence and Lone Star Corporate College.

Lone Star College-System Office employees are based at one of two System Office locations; The Woodlands and University Park. Both are the site for multiple administrative departments and system-wide training programs.

Location address is 5000 Research Forest Drive, The Woodlands, TX77381.

Job Description
Purpose and Scope

The Coordinator III provides oversight and facilitation of day-to-day and some long-term operations within a large and/or System-wide area of specialty, playing a strong role in leading, planning, developing, evaluating, and improving area of responsibility. Assigned area and responsibilities will be extensive and/or highly specialized. May be responsible for the success of the assigned area, ensuring smooth and efficient operations as well as compliance with policies, procedures and a variety of local, state and federal regulations. Coordinates logistics, services and support surrounding significant/diverse programs or departments. Makes and communicates process decisions based on best practices.

Essential Job Functions
  1. Oversees daily and some long-term operations of assigned area. Actively maintains up-to-date knowledge of area and acts as a Subject Matter Expert within area and as a point of contact and liaison for internal and external constituents
  2. Performs research relevant to area of specialty. Develops, monitors and maintains a variety of spreadsheets, databases, reports, and presents findings to internal/external constituents (may include LSCS Managers/Executives, community members, and/or outside groups and organizations)
  3. Enter, tracks and maintains a variety of data, including documents, spreadsheets and databases
  4. May be responsible for ensuring and maintaining compliance with local/state/federal compliance of processes and documentation within assigned area
  5. Supervises, trains and develops department staff. Schedules and prioritizes work and activities and develops and organizes training materials
  6. Creates methods of evaluation of assigned area. Analyzes results and makes recommendations for revisions to objectives and strategies, with a focus on continuous program improvement. Takes part (or takes Lead) in developing new programs.
  7. Coordinates and manages various department and management calendars and schedules. Plans, schedules and coordinates various meetings/seminars/events, including site selection and preparation, marketing and training materials, and general support.
  8. Monitors and controls resources such as office supplies and equipment needed within the department. Submits requisitions, and reviews and approves/denies purchase requests in accordance with the budget.
  9. Manages or assists with management of the department budget
  10. Takes part in and/or leads special projects as needed
  11. Responsible for other reasonable related duties as assigned
